White water rafting in Peru is an exhilarating adventure that allows you to experience the breathtaking landscapes and vibrant culture of this Andean nation. The most popular rafting destinations are the rivers near Cusco and the Sacred Valley, where you can navigate thrilling rapids surrounded by stunning mountains and lush valleys.
One of the most renowned rivers for white water rafting is the Urubamba River, known for its spectacular views and challenging rapids. Most rafting tours cater to varying skill levels, from beginners to advanced, making it accessible for everyone. The best time to go rafting in Peru is from May to September, when water levels are typically ideal for adventure seekers.
Many tour operators offer half-day or full-day rafting excursions, which often include transportation from Cusco, safety gear, and experienced guides. A typical trip will start with a safety briefing, where guides will teach you essential paddling techniques and safety measures. As you navigate the rapids, keep your eyes peeled for local wildlife, including birds and sometimes even llamas along the riverbanks.
Rafting is not just about the adrenaline; it’s also an opportunity to immerse yourself in the rich cultural tapestry of the region. Many tours include a stop at a traditional village where you can learn about local customs and perhaps enjoy a delicious Peruvian meal. Make sure to bring a change of clothes and a waterproof camera to capture the amazing moments.
After your rafting adventure, consider visiting Machu Picchu to complete your Peruvian journey. You can take the scenic train from Cusco to Aguas Calientes, the gateway to the ancient Inca site. The combination of white water rafting and exploring Machu Picchu offers a unique way to experience the adventure and history of Peru.
For those looking to extend their stay, consider additional activities like hiking, zip-lining, or cultural workshops that delve deeper into the local traditions. Whether you are an adrenaline junkie or a cultural enthusiast, white water rafting in Peru is an unforgettable experience that should be on your travel itinerary.
